Latvian beach volleyball duo record tournament victory

Latvian women’s beach volleyball team Tina Graudina and Anastasija Kravcenoka triumphed at the Beach Volleyball European Championship 2019 in Moscow on August 10, beating Poland’s Katarzyna Kociolek/Kinga Wojtasik in the final match.

Graudina/Kravcenoka defeated Kociolek/Wojtasik 2-0 (22:20, 21:19), winning EuroBeachVolley gold medals for Latvia for the first time since 2009 when the title went to Inguna Minusa and Inese Jursone.

Graudina/Kravcenoka already played Kociolek/Wojtasik in the pool stage of the tournament, winning that match 2-0 (24-22, 21-18).

On August 12, President Egils Levits took to social media to show that he had written letters of congratulation to the winning duo.
